Vinicius Jr’s Deal Renewal Hits a Roadblock at Real Madrid
The 25-year-old attacker, committed to Real Madrid through 2027, had been on the cusp of a prolonged commitment extending to 2030 just months ago. Discussions advanced significantly post-Club World Cup, with mutual agreement on a package exceeding €18m annually, inclusive of incentives-marking a notable upgrade from his existing €15m compensation.
Reasons Behind the Negotiation Freeze
Progress suddenly stopped when a key session at the team’s facility was deferred, and no follow-up has occurred, as per reports. Real Madrid maintains that the dialogue isn’t terminated, merely postponed, while the player’s representatives stay observant yet composed.

Growing Strains with Manager Xabi Alonso
Friction between Vinicius Jr and the newly appointed coach Xabi Alonso began in July during the Club World Cup semi-final, where the player was omitted from the starting lineup. Their rapport has since deteriorated, with Vinicius Jr featuring as a starter in just three of the team’s 13 outings this season, often being pulled early or used as a reserve despite performing well.
The Clasico Incident as a Turning Point
The situation escalated in the 2-1 victory against Barcelona, when Vinicius Jr exited the field in the 72nd minute, vocally expressing discontent with “Always me!” and vanishing into the tunnel. Footage later showed him visibly upset on the sidelines.
Questioning Alonso’s Approach and Its Impact on Vinicius Jr
Internally, doubts have emerged about Alonso’s strategies, as some teammates believe his strict tactics curb creative talents. Having thrived under Carlo Ancelotti’s more liberated style, Vinicius Jr is now adapting to a regime that favors structure over spontaneity, raising uncertainties about whether his dynamic, fast-paced approach aligns with Alonso’s methodical vision for Real Madrid.
Vinicius Jr’s Public Statement and Underlying Tensions
Shortly after the Clasico clash, Vinicius Jr issued a statement: “I extend my regrets to my colleagues, supporters, the organization, and its leader. My enthusiasm can sometimes overpower me in my quest for victory.” Notably, Alonso’s name was absent, which drew immediate scrutiny.
Deeper Issues and External Views
This exclusion was deliberate, according to insiders familiar with the group, who revealed Vinicius Jr’s dissatisfaction with restricted minutes and being deployed in unfamiliar roles on the flank. While his remorse was genuine for the fanbase, it exposed the widening gap between the forward and his coach. Criticism soon poured in, with ex-French player Christophe Dugarry calling him “insufferable” and pointing to a lack of growth. However, within Real Madrid, there’s understanding, as veterans like Luka Modric and Dani Carvajal have encouraged resolution. For club president Florentino Perez, fostering harmony between last season’s leading scorer and the current helm is essential.
External Interest and Future Uncertainties for Vinicius Jr at Real Madrid
With negotiations at a standstill and tensions mounting, Paris Saint-Germain is keeping a keen eye. The French club views Vinicius Jr as a prime acquisition if he opts to depart next year, appreciating his potential in Luis Enrique’s aggressive, forward-driven setup that could maximize his speed and energy.
Risks of Prolonged Stalemate
Real Madrid firmly states that the player is not available for transfer, but ongoing disputes might alter this stance. As his contract nears its 2027 end without fresh discussions, the club could face a precarious scenario where Vinicius Jr gains the upper hand.
